NEW DELHI : The Department of Training & Technical Education, Delhi, has issued the Delhi ITI 2024 round 4 seat allotment results today, August 27. Candidates can find the results on Delhi ITI’s official website, itidelhi.admissions.nic.in. Candidates who have been allotted seats can freeze them after logging in to their account.
The allotted seats will only be confirmed after the payment of the acceptance fees. The last date to make the Delhi ITI 2024 admission fee payment is September 1.
Delhi ITI 2024 counselling round 4 schedule
Candidates will be able to freeze their allotted seats for Delhi ITI counselling from August 28 till August 30, 4:30 pm. The physical verification of the original documents of candidates at the allotted institute will begin from August 28 to August 30 till 5 pm. The online submission of the admission fee will begin on August 28 and continue till September 1, 11:59 pm.
Delhi ITI 2024 counselling: Required documents
The below-mentioned documents are required for Delhi ITI 2024 admissions.
-
Copy of seat allotment letter
-
Copy of provisional admission slip
-
All original certificates
-
Set of self-attested photocopies of documents to be submitted at the allotted ITI
-
Medical fitness certificate
-
Self attested prohibition of ragging undertaking
-
Undertaking
-
Self-attested character certificate
-
Aadhar card of the candidate
-
Three Photo of the candidate
